Impact if not Resolved: |
High |
Impact Description: |
If this integration is not allowed, many customers will feel they have no way to successfully take care of their payments to multiple jurisdictions. They will be forced to resort back to trying to keep track of paying each jurisdiction separately at a much higher monthly payment for each court. Most customers on the UP Program participate because it is easier to remember to make one payment than it is to try to make separate payments to multiple jurisdictions.

What is the Business Problem or Opportunity |
This is a request to allow Catalis (aka: NCourt) to integrate with the new CLJ-CMS system to accepted and process payments for multiple jurisdictions. A number of CLJs participate in the Unified Payment (UP) Program. This program allows persons with outstanding LFOs in multiple jurisdictions to submit a single payment through Catalis that will be evenly distributed to all courts participating in the program. This makes it more convenience for the court customer to pay their LFOs with ease. There are currently 39 CLJs participating in the program and it is our goal to make this a statewide program.
I asked if the new eJustice system will allow for cross jurisdictional payments, and I was informed that the new system does not have this capability. Allowing Catalis to intergrate and continue to provide this service to the courts will maintain the efficienies we need to help court customers successfully take care of their outstanding LFOs.
